Output ee5707ac1624fe31e65591ce0abf20167202d1bdcf869bf94909caa113399fd5:3

value
676170983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a6086ade64eee6072af8336282efe0873e37807 OP_EQUAL
address
MPS2jnsfTgzbfST39NyYu9V99495P6AWLK
transaction
ee5707ac1624fe31e65591ce0abf20167202d1bdcf869bf94909caa113399fd5
spent
true